We are currently seeking an experienced Senior Business Analyst to join our high-performing, diverse, and innovative consulting team, supporting a large-scale SAP S/4HANA implementation for a well-established client within the nuclear sector.
The Opportunity
The Senior Business Analyst will drive SAP Finance solution design, process improvement, and stakeholder engagement to support efficient, compliant, and scalable financial operations. This role bridges finance domain expertise with SAP functional configuration, working closely with both business stakeholders and technical delivery teams. The engagement is in the design phase with user stories already drafted, so the role includes reviewing and refining existing finance user stories for completeness and testability, not only gathering new requirements.

Key Responsibilities:
Lead finance process assessments to identify gaps, inefficiencies, and control issues across SAP (ECC and S/4HANA) workflows.
Facilitate workshops with Finance stakeholders to gather requirements, define future-state processes, and align on measurable outcomes.
Review and refine the existing drafted user stories for the finance workstream, ensuring they are complete, correctly scoped, and testable, and confirming acceptance criteria before build.
Design and configure SAP Finance solutions, including Record to Report (R2R), Procure to Pay (P2P/AP), Order to Cash (O2C/AR), Asset Accounting, and banking and cash processes.
Design and validate the capital-project-to-asset flow, including Project System and WBS, Investment Management, and settlement of assets under construction to fixed assets, in line with the needs of a capital-intensive organization.
Translate business requirements into clear functional specifications, configuration designs, and testable acceptance criteria.
Partner with development and integration teams to deliver enhancements, interfaces, workflows, forms, and reporting solutions, accounting for finance integration points with MM, SD, PS, and PM.
Lead functional and module-level testing for the finance workstream, including test script development, defect triage, and regression validation, in coordination with the QA Lead who owns the overall program test strategy, integration testing, and automation.
Support deployment activities including cutover planning, data validation, hypercare, and production support with root-cause analysis.
Act as a trusted advisor to Finance stakeholders on SAP-enabled process improvements, compliance, controls, and best practices.
Qualifications & Experience
4-year university degree in Finance, Accounting, Business Administration, or a related field.
6-8 years of relevant experience in finance business analysis and SAP functional work.
Strong functional expertise in SAP Finance with hands-on configuration experience, including demonstrated S/4HANA Finance delta knowledge such as the Universal Journal (ACDOCA), new Asset Accounting, new General Ledger and parallel ledgers, and Group Reporting. Experience limited to ECC FICO is not sufficient on its own.
Demonstrated end-to-end knowledge of finance processes including R2R, P2P (AP), O2C (AR), and Asset Accounting.
Hands-on experience with the capital-project-to-asset flow, including Project System and WBS, settlement of assets under construction to fixed assets, and Investment Management, is strongly preferred given the capital-intensive nature of the client.
Proven experience leading business process improvement initiatives and driving operational efficiencies within finance functions.
Ability to translate complex business requirements into structured functional designs and testable deliverables.
Experience supporting the full project lifecycle, including requirements gathering, design, testing, deployment, and post-go-live support.
Strong stakeholder engagement skills, with the ability to facilitate workshops and influence cross-functional teams.
Excellent analytical, communication, and documentation skills, including experience developing process documentation and training materials.
Experience within a regulated or audited environment (for example nuclear, utilities, or energy) and awareness of financial controls and segregation of duties is an asset.
